Output e1b3bb2c7a89717a2de1a9d1cde608bb709dfe03f717cfc907efa67ceca6380b:421

value
2585068
script pubkey
OP_0 OP_PUSHBYTES_20 7543ce202e4af71603e1916f01609198045c01ab
address
bc1qw4puugpwftm3vqlpj9hszcy3nqz9cqdtcfjcu4
transaction
e1b3bb2c7a89717a2de1a9d1cde608bb709dfe03f717cfc907efa67ceca6380b
confirmations
103727
spent
true